Output 53bdfba85fe1928f6efad42cadbdf1d004ee71cf4026e5038b518c607002594b:1

value
1631746860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c15cd577224c96a2bef0c882ff5b04addda1eb9 OP_EQUALVERIFY OP_CHECKSIG
address
1526rH8Uj52D7KnbJ2o8BXroXPPEwBNiXw
transaction
53bdfba85fe1928f6efad42cadbdf1d004ee71cf4026e5038b518c607002594b
spent
true